Twyla Juanzell Taylor, Age 59

Moore, OK
Search Report

Known As:

Twyla J Taylor, Twyla Juanzell Toombs, Twyla J Toombs, Tywla J Toombs, Twala J Toombs

Phone Numbers
(405) 348-6277 + 4 more
Used to Live in
1201 SW 98Th St, Oklahoma City, OK 73139 + 7 more
UNLOCK REPORT

Phones and Addresses

View All Info

FAQ about Twyla Juanzell Taylor

  • What is Twyla Juanzell Taylor’s phone number?

    Twyla Juanzell Taylor’s phone number is (405) 348-6277.

  • What is Twyla Juanzell Taylor’s date of birth?

    Twyla Juanzell Taylor was born on 1966.